What Are Regenerated PS Plastic Pellets?

Regenerated PS (polystyrene) plastic pellets are high-quality, recycled polymer materials processed from post-consumer or post-industrial polystyrene waste. These pellets are designed to match the performance of virgin PS in manufacturing applications, offering similar physical properties while promoting sustainability.

By converting waste into reusable material, regenerated PS helps reduce landfill burden and raw material consumption, supporting eco-friendly manufacturing practices.


How Are Regenerated PS Plastic Pellets Made?

The production of regenerated PS pellets involves several meticulous steps to ensure consistent quality and performance:

  • Collection: Polystyrene waste is collected from industrial scrap, packaging, and other post-consumer sources.
  • Sorting: Contaminants such as metals, labels, and other plastics are removed to ensure purity.
  • Cleaning: The sorted PS material is washed thoroughly to eliminate dirt and residues.
  • Shredding & Grinding: Clean PS waste is shredded into smaller flakes for uniformity in melting and extrusion.
  • Extrusion: The flakes are melted and reformed into uniform pellets using an extrusion process.
  • Cooling & Packaging: Pellets are cooled, dried, and packaged, ready for industrial use.

What Are the Advantages of Using Regenerated PS Pellets?

Manufacturers are increasingly switching to regenerated PS plastic pellets for a variety of reasons:

Benefit Description
Cost Savings Regenerated PS is significantly cheaper than virgin material, reducing production expenses.
Environmental Sustainability Recycling polystyrene minimizes landfill waste and lowers carbon footprint.
Consistent Quality Modern processing techniques ensure uniformity in pellet size, density, and physical properties.
Versatility Can be used in injection molding, extrusion, thermoforming, and other common PS applications.
Regulatory Compliance Produced to meet international standards for recycled plastics, ensuring safe use in multiple industries.

Where Can Regenerated PS Pellets Be Used?

Regenerated PS pellets are highly versatile and suitable for a wide range of applications across industries:

  • Packaging: Food containers, cups, trays, and protective packaging.
  • Consumer Products: Toys, household appliances, and decorative items.
  • Construction Materials: Insulation panels, lightweight components, and molded sheets.
  • Industrial Applications: Automotive parts, electronics housing, and equipment casings.
